Interface ICollectionFixture<TFixture>

Used to decorate xUnit.net test classes and collections to indicate a test which has per-test-collection fixture data. An instance of the fixture data is initialized just before the first test in the collection is run, and if it implements IDisposable, is disposed after the last test in the collection is run. To gain access to the fixture data from inside the test, a constructor argument should be added to the test class which exactly matches the TFixture.

Namespace: Xunit
Assembly: xunit.core.dll
Syntax
public interface ICollectionFixture<TFixture>

    where TFixture : class
Type Parameters
Name Description
TFixture

The type of the fixture.

Remarks

If asynchronous setup of TFixture is required it should implement the IAsyncLifetime interface.
